Leisure and Bean is the cafe at the Fremantle Leisure Centre on Shuffrey Street, with a grab-and-go window straight onto the street. The outdoor setup and easy parking make it a handy post-walk or post-swim coffee stop with a dog.

The dog setup. Dogs are welcome in the outdoor seating around the cafe, not inside the main building. The Shuffrey Street grab-and-go window is genuinely useful, as you can order without leaving your dog tied up out of sight. Staff are pet-friendly; bring your own bowl, as water is not guaranteed.

Good to know. Run by experienced owners formerly of Little Stove, it is rated highly for coffee, with fresh banana bread, brownies, bagels, toasties and salads. Hours run daily mornings to early afternoon.

Getting there. Find it at 10 Shuffrey Street, with ample parking in the Leisure Centre car park and direct access off Shuffrey Street, which makes it easy to fold into a walk.

Nearby with the dogs. Fremantle Park is a few minutes' walk for a large green leg-stretch, and central Fremantle is a short walk on for more wandering.

When to go. A weekday mid-morning is the calmest, outside the busiest swim-school hours. Grab a coffee from the window and settle at an outdoor table with room for the lead.
